Top 5 Disney Games on iOS in Austria Q3 2021
Discover the performance of the top 5 Disney games on iOS in Austria during Q3 2021, including trends in downloads, revenue, and active users.
During Q3 2021, the top 5 Disney games on the iOS platform in Austria showed varied performance trends in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at how each game fared according to Sensor Tower data.
MARVEL Future Revolution by Netmarble Corporation, released on August 24, 2021, saw its weekly revenue peak at around $2.6K in the first week of September before declining to $969 by the end of the quarter. The game started strong with 4.5K downloads in its launch week but experienced a steady decrease, reaching 477 by the last week of September. Active users followed a similar pattern, beginning at 3.7K and dropping to 854 by quarter’s end.
The Simpsons™: Tapped Out from Electronic Arts maintained a fairly consistent revenue stream, peaking at approximately $2.3K in early August and then fluctuating, ending the quarter at $333. Downloads were low overall but saw a spike to 530 in the final week of September. Active user numbers hovered around 4K for most of the quarter, with a slight increase to 4.7K by the end of September.
Disney Coloring World by StoryToys Limited had modest revenue figures, peaking at $317 in late June and fluctuating throughout the quarter, ending at $73. Downloads were relatively steady, ranging between 90 and 165, with a slight dip mid-quarter. Active users remained stable, around 200, with little variation over the months.
MARVEL Strike Force: Squad RPG, published by Scopely, Inc., saw significant revenue fluctuations, peaking at $5K in mid-August and maintaining strong figures throughout the quarter, closing at $3.3K. Download numbers were low, with a notable spike to 373 in early July, but generally stayed below 100 for most of the quarter. Active users were stable, around 500-700, with minor weekly variations.
Disney Magic Kingdoms by Gameloft showed a peak revenue of $791 in early September, with figures generally fluctuating between $339 and $787. Downloads saw a significant jump to 429 in late August but were otherwise low. Active users increased from around 500 in June to 713 in late August, then declined slightly to 408 by the end of September.
